1. Set your voice or instrument and dB Calibration in Section 1 below.
2. Upload audio files for your fff (loud) and ppp (soft) recordings in all registers .
3. Click "Analyse" to extract a big bunch of audio features for musical instruments or singing/speaking voice analysis.
4. Explore the Phonetogram and the detailed Timbre Sections.
5. Hover directly over the data points to playback the original audio file.
6 View and export Data Table as CSV Export.
7 View and save the Summary Report & Evaluation

7. Tuning, Intonation, Pitch Stability & Inharmonicity
Top: Pitch deviation from the nearest equal-tempered note (A4 = 440 Hz) in Cents.
Middle: Spectral Inharmonicity (Deviation of harmonics from the ideal harmonic series).
Bottom: Pitch Instability (Standard deviation of pitch within the file in Cents, e.g. Vibrato/Wobble).
